Review

This white paper makes a serious and useful argument: foundation models should be treated not merely as innovation outputs, but as strategic infrastructure. For India, that means indigenous models matter not only for industrial policy, but for linguistic inclusion, public-sector relevance, sovereign capability, and long-run bargaining power in a world increasingly shaped by upstream AI dependencies. The paper directly advances the analysis when it rejects frontier-model theater and instead advances a layered ecosystem view: large domestic models where needed, smaller domain-specific models where practical, multimodal systems where real-world conditions demand them, all backed by shared compute, shared datasets, and India-centric benchmarks.

That is the good part, and it is genuinely good. The paper also correctly situates this agenda within a broader governance landscape spanning the DPDP Act, emerging synthetic-content regulation, copyright debates, and evaluation initiatives. In other words, it understands that compute, data, law, and benchmarking have to move together.

Where it falls short is the place where many policy papers politely evaporate: operationalisation. It says accountability, transparency, and benchmarking matter, but does not adequately specify the enforcement layer. What evidence should model developers provide? What documentation should public procurement require? Who certifies sectoral suitability? What incident-reporting, red-teaming, or post-deployment monitoring obligations attach to models used in health, education, welfare, or citizen-facing systems? Without those answers, the governance stack remains aspirational.

So the paper is directionally strong and strategically important, but incomplete. Its real value lies in framing indigenous foundation models as national capability infrastructure. Its next iteration should turn that framing into deployment-grade machinery: assurance artifacts, risk-tiered adoption rules, benchmark-linked procurement, and clear lifecycle accountability.
